Output ded03867f44b8af3f6ad537712a426c80b58f57bbc9a1e3b787d0731e1a56b6a:1

value
100287795
script pubkey
OP_0 OP_PUSHBYTES_20 bd0fdbc97647668c9a56d2fd43b5a9e68a1a0b97
address
bc1qh58ahjtkgangexjk6t758ddfu69p5zuh0y6rps
transaction
ded03867f44b8af3f6ad537712a426c80b58f57bbc9a1e3b787d0731e1a56b6a
confirmations
115861
spent
true